Erythrochiton is a genus of plant in family Rutaceae. It contains the following species (but this list may be incomplete): Erythrochiton brasiliensis Nees & Mart. Erythrochiton delitescens Morton Erythrochiton fallax Kallunki Erythrochiton giganteus Kaastra & A.H.Gentry Erythrochiton gymnanthus Kallunki Erythrochiton hypophyllanthus Planch. & Linden Erythrochiton lindenii Planch. & Linden Erythrochiton macrophyllum Makoy ex Hook. Erythrochiton macropodum K.Krause Erythrochiton odontoglossus Kallunki Erythrochiton trichanthus Kallunki Erythrochiton trifoliatum Pilg. Many species of this genus are characterised by having epiphyllous flowers, which emerge from the leaf itself, rather than the more usual site of a leaf axil, a plant axis, or its inflorescence....read more on Wikipedia.
